Description: HSFs (Heat Shock family of transcription factors), which consists of HSF 1-4, bind to highly conserved Heat shock elements (HSEs) in the promoter regions of heat shock genes, ultimately regulating the expression of Heat shock proteins (Hsps). On exposure to heat shock and other stresses, HSF1 localizes within seconds to discrete nuclear granules and on recovery from stress, HSF1 rapidly dissipates from the stress granules to a diffuse nucleoplasmic distribution.

Description: The 104 kDa yeast heat shock protein (Hsp104) is a cytosolic member of the Hsp100 family of proteins. Hsp104 cooperates with Hsp40 and Hsp70 co-chaperones in yeast in the reactivation of heat-damaged proteins. Hsp104 is also critical for the establishment and maintenance of the [PSI] prion phenotype in Saccharomyces cerevesiae.

Description: Hsp20 is a small heat shock protein related to Hsp25, Hsp27 and may form different hetercomplexes with these proteins. The specific physiological function of Hsp20 is not yet known. It is distributed ubiquitously in tissues, but is found in higher levels in skeletal, smooth and heart muscle. Under normal conditions, Hsp20 is diffusely distributed in the cytosol, but under heat stress conditions, it translocates to the nucleus. Unlike other heat shock proteins the amount of Hsp20 does not increase after heat shock. The Hsp20 was demonstrated to constitute up to 1.3% of the total cellular protein in vertebrate tissues, especially in muscle, and its expression is related to muscle contraction, specifically in slow-twitch muscle. Hsp20 may form different heterocomplexes with other Hsp's, such as alpha-crystalline and Hsp25. Phosphorylated form of Hsp20 is proposed to interact with monomeric actin whereas dephosphorylated form binds polymeric actin filaments. In normal conditions Hsp20 is diffusely disturbed in cytosol but under the heat stress it undergoes translocation to membrane fraction.
